why is dna profiling considered a valid means of identification? describe the structure of dna. how does dna relate to genes and chromosomes?

Answer:

DNA profiling is considered a valid means of identification because each person (except identical twins) has a unique DNA sequence. The structure of DNA is a double - helix, composed of nucleotides which contain a sugar, a phosphate group, and a nitrogenous base. Genes are segments of DNA that carry the instructions for making proteins. Chromosomes are long strands of DNA tightly coiled around proteins. DNA is the genetic material that makes up genes and chromosomes, with genes being specific functional units within the DNA molecule and chromosomes being the organized structures that house DNA in the cell nucleus.
